Advantages of VoIP for Businesses
One of the primary benefits of using VoIP phone systems is cost savings. Conventional telephone systems often involve significant charges for overseas calls and long-distance communication. With voice over IP technology, calls are transmitted over the internet, significantly reducing costs associated with call fees. This is especially beneficial for businesses with extensive communication needs, enabling them to allocate resources more efficiently.
Scalability is another important benefit of VoIP telephone systems. As businesses grow, their communication needs evolve, and legacy phone systems can be hard and expensive to change. VoIP solutions provide the ability to easily insert or eliminate lines, change features, and increase capacity without the need for extensive hardware changes. This versatility allows companies to scale their operations smoothly without sacrificing communication quality.
Finally, VoIP systems offer enhanced features that increase overall business productivity. Many VoIP telephone systems come with advanced functionalities such as voicemail to email, video conferencing, and call forwarding, which are not typically available with traditional systems. These features streamline communication and collaboration, enabling teams to work more efficiently, regardless of their physical location. As a result, businesses using VoIP can improve their responsiveness and customer service skills.
Selecting the Appropriate VoIP Solution
Choosing the best VoIP phone solution is vital for boosting interaction efficiency inside your business. First, evaluate the size and requirements of your organization. A tiny company may profit from a simpler, budget-friendly VoIP system, whereas bigger companies may need further advanced features such as call management, conference functions, and connection with additional software options. Understanding your specific needs can help you reduce down the choices.
One more crucial aspect to assess is the extent of support and service given by the VoIP vendor. Reliable customer service can make a significant distinction, particularly during critical working hours. Look for providers that provide round-the-clock service, along with options for teaching your employees on how to operate the VoIP solution effectively. This support will ensure that any concerns can be fixed quickly to minimize downtime.
In conclusion, examine the scalability of the VoIP telephone systems you are considering. As your business grows, your communication may evolve, and it is crucial to choose a system that can readily grow. Look for VoIP solutions that allow you to insert or delete users and features without complicated upgrades. This adaptability is important for ensuring cost-effectiveness and making sure your VoIP solution can respond to forthcoming needs.
